Simon Glass
9db339213d
buildman: Fix flaky test_kconfig_change test properly
...
The previous fix using -T4 is insufficient because queue-based job
distribution does not guarantee one board per thread. Even with 4
threads and 4 boards, a faster thread can finish its board and grab
another from the queue, causing .config to leak between boards in
the same thread's work directory.
Fix by using -P (per-board-out-dir) which gives each board its own
output directory, completely preventing .config leakage regardless
of thread scheduling.
Fixes: 17618b5975 ("buildman: Fix flaky test_kconfig_change test")
Co-developed-by: Claude Opus 4.5 <noreply@anthropic.com >
Signed-off-by: Simon Glass <simon.glass@canonical.com >
2025-12-27 13:24:09 -07:00
..
2025-07-26 23:55:02 +12:00
2025-12-27 13:24:09 -07:00
2025-12-08 17:37:36 -07:00
2025-12-24 05:17:02 -07:00
2025-08-20 07:41:19 -06:00
2024-10-21 20:51:23 -06:00
2024-07-15 12:12:18 -06:00
2023-12-15 15:41:23 +01:00
2025-12-27 04:51:56 -07:00
2025-12-24 14:26:41 -07:00
2025-12-16 16:09:53 -07:00
2025-05-27 10:14:31 +01:00
2025-08-01 13:20:42 +12:00
2025-08-01 13:20:42 +12:00
2025-08-01 13:20:42 +12:00
2025-08-01 13:05:12 +12:00
2024-09-12 17:35:37 +02:00
2024-07-15 12:12:18 -06:00
2024-10-18 14:10:22 -06:00
2024-07-15 12:12:18 -06:00
2025-05-01 05:56:48 -06:00
2025-08-01 13:05:12 +12:00
2025-08-01 13:20:42 +12:00
2025-11-19 19:51:46 -07:00
2025-11-19 19:37:40 -07:00
2025-08-01 13:20:42 +12:00
2025-08-01 13:20:42 +12:00
2025-08-01 13:20:42 +12:00
2025-11-19 19:37:40 -07:00
2024-10-21 17:52:52 -06:00
2025-08-01 13:20:42 +12:00
2025-08-04 14:39:59 -06:00
2024-07-15 12:12:18 -06:00
2025-08-01 13:20:42 +12:00
2025-08-01 13:20:42 +12:00
2025-05-27 10:10:06 +01:00
2024-11-25 23:07:37 -03:00
2025-08-01 13:20:42 +12:00
2023-10-09 15:24:31 -04:00
2025-05-27 10:14:31 +01:00
2025-08-01 13:20:42 +12:00
2025-04-29 12:43:50 -06:00
2025-08-01 13:20:42 +12:00
2025-11-19 19:50:09 -07:00
2025-02-25 06:33:57 -07:00
2025-09-04 07:08:24 -06:00
2025-04-29 12:43:50 -06:00
2024-05-24 13:40:04 -06:00
2025-08-04 14:39:59 -06:00
2025-11-18 17:02:33 -07:00
2025-08-01 13:20:42 +12:00
2023-08-03 09:40:50 -04:00
2023-12-13 15:33:57 -03:00
2025-08-01 13:20:42 +12:00
2025-08-01 13:20:42 +12:00
2025-08-01 13:20:42 +12:00
2025-05-27 10:14:31 +01:00
2025-04-29 12:43:50 -06:00
2025-08-04 19:37:20 +00:00
2023-09-06 13:28:29 +02:00
2025-08-01 13:20:42 +12:00
2025-04-29 12:43:50 -06:00
2025-08-01 13:20:42 +12:00
2025-08-01 13:20:42 +12:00
2025-08-01 13:20:42 +12:00
2025-08-01 13:20:42 +12:00
2025-02-09 12:10:30 -07:00
2025-08-01 13:20:42 +12:00
2025-08-01 13:20:42 +12:00
2025-08-01 13:20:42 +12:00
2025-08-01 13:20:42 +12:00
2025-08-01 13:20:42 +12:00
2025-08-01 13:20:42 +12:00
2024-07-31 11:20:36 -06:00
2025-08-01 13:20:42 +12:00
2025-08-01 13:20:42 +12:00
2025-08-01 13:20:42 +12:00
2025-08-01 13:20:42 +12:00
2025-08-01 13:20:42 +12:00